On Monday, May 12, Samsung finally dropped the mic with the release of their latest smartphone, the Galaxy S25 Edge. This ultra-thin beauty boasts a body just 5.8mm thick and a price tag starting at $1,099.99. The Samsung Galaxy S25 Edge: Let’s talk numbers

With a Snapdragon 8 Elite processor and a laundry list of impressive specs, the S25 Edge holds its own against its pricier siblings. Featuring a 6.7-inch AMOLED display, 12GB of RAM, 256GB/512GB storage options, and a 200MP main rear camera, this phone packs a punch. While it may lack the Ultra’s telephoto lens, it’s got all the essential features and then some. Plus, Samsung threw in a Corning Gorilla Glass Ceramic 2 front display for added durability.
